CMX7031 and CMX7041: two-way radio processor platform ICs built on FirmASIC® technology.
The specific function and feature-set of the IC platform is determined by the loading of a small data file, the
Function Image (FI) file.

The CMX7031 and CMX7041 two-way radio processors enable a revolutionary new platform approach to radio design.
They provide a comprehensive feature-set as standard plus a roadmap of function enhancements available through CML’s FirmASIC® technology.
The CMX7031 and CMX7041 are full-function, half-duplex, audio, signalling and data processor ICs.
They are suitable for implementation in professional radio (PMR/LMR, Trunking), Leisure radio
(GMRS, FRS, PMR446, and MURS) and Marine VHF, Aviation and Amateur radio products. These products provide
concurrent sub-audio band and in-band signalling, complete audio processing and a comprehensive data
modem implementation.
The FFSK/MSK data modem provides a freeformat synchronised data mode, utilising CRC, FEC, interleaving and scrambling.
The half-duplex 4-level FSK modem is suitable for use in PMR/LMR radios. In conjunction with a suitable host µcontroller and radio modules, this provides the digital baseband processing to implement a radio function to satisfy the requirements of ETS 102 490 and EN 301 166 or EN 300 113.
The half-duplex C4FM modem suitable for use in PMR/LMR radio designs in conjunction with a suitable host controller and RF circuits.
The CMX7031 features two on-chip RF synthesisers that can be used for efficient switching of the radio
between Rx and Tx operating modes.
To enable full control of the radio functions and minimise the overall chip count, two user programmable
system clock outputs and auxiliary ADC and DAC blocks are available.
A user-programmable PLL, driven from the Xtal/reference clock input, generates all internal clocks.
This supports a wide selection of Xtal/reference clock frequencies and allows one clock source to be
internally reused for both baseband and RF synthesiser functions (for CMX7031 only).
A flexible power control facility allows the device to maximise powersaving whilst not processing
signals or when specific functions are not enabled.
